发明名称 CHESS GAME USING SPECIALIZED DICE
摘要 A method of playing a game where two players use a checkered game board, three specialized dice, and traditional chess pieces. More specifically, the checkered game board can be a traditional eight-by-eight chessboard, or it can be an expanded ten-by-ten board. Additionally, the three specialized dice each display one traditional chess piece per side of the die. Therefore, each die will have one king, one queen, one rook, one knight, one bishop, and one pawn depicted on it. In its most basic sense, the game involves making movements each turn based on the depictions that show ‘up’ when the three dice are rolled.
